Session 1: Foundations of Bulk-RNAseq Library Preparation

Register: https://schedule.yale.edu/event/11974573


Presenter: Dr. Bony De Kumar, Yale Center for Genomic Analysis

Summary: Explore the core principles and techniques of bulk-RNAseq library preparation. This introductory session lays the groundwork for understanding the complexities of bulk RNA-seq experiments.

In this talk, Dr. Bony De Kumar, Director of operations at the Yale Center for Genome Analysis will review Basic aspects of gene expression analysis. This session will elaborate on various types of RNA-Seq methods and their applications.

You will learn how to:

  • Different approaches to sequence RNA
  • Various methods of RNA-Seq library preparation and their downstream application
  • RNA Quality requirements
  • Full length RNA Sequencing approaches and epitranscriptomics
